The drama surrounding the split of Hollywood legend Clint Eastwood and his wife of 17 years Dina Eastwood just got a little more bizarre.

Not only has it been reported that Dina has moved on with her old high school sweetheart Scott Fisher, but now it's been revealed that the Oscar winner has been spending time with Scott's ex-wife Erica Tomlinson-Fisher.

On Saturday the Dirty Harry actor was spotted dropping the stunning fortysomething off at an LA airport, the National Enquirer reported.

Dressed in a fetching leopard maxi dress with her long blonde locks flowing down her back and her tan skin glowing, it's not hard to see why the suddenly single celebrity would want to keep her company.
